Upwelling usually refers to the rising up of denser, deep-sea cold water to the surface of the ocean, replacing the less dense warm air.

It takes place both near the coastal areas and in the broad open ocean.

The deeper cold water is highly rich in the valuable nutrients, and as they rise up they carry these nutrients and distribute them in the upper region of the ocean water body. The marine organisms are directly dependent on these nutrients, thereby helps in biological productivity.

Thus, the intense upwelling occurring in a particular area in the ocean signifies the abundance of marine species.

Water, which is able to exist in three different states moves from one form to another. Water can move from the ocean to the atmosphere via a process called EVAPORATION. During the process of evaporation, the sun plays a major role by supplying the HEAT ENERGY required to change water from its liquid form in the ocean to its gaseous form in the atmosphere.

Water cycle of the earth helps ensure that water is not lost in any of its forms. Liquid water stored in the ocean gets evaporated as a result of heat energy into the atmosphere as water vapour.
